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a residential sewage tank needs to be professionally inspected at least every 3 to 5 years by skilled professionals. Throughout this process, the professional examiners will check for seepage, inspect the top and base of your waste tank, evaluate the accumulated scum and sludge in your sewage tank, and perform skilled maintenance of your waste t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
Minimizing water usage in a residence equates to less water going into the septic tank. Restroom usage makes up approximately 25-30% of water consumption in the residential property. An optimal method to reduce water usage in the restroom is by substituting older models with low-flow fixtures, employing fewer gallons of water for each fl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ized when bathing additionally directed into the septic tank. To minimize this, a prudent step involves using low-flow shower heads, crafted to lower water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Numerous folks possess the bad practice of dealing with the toilet as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, engaging in this conduct inevitably sewage system clogs. So, householders must ensure that everyone in the household gets rid of refuse properly and doesn't flush it down the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
Just as maintaining the septic system annually, seasonal care is just as important to provide seasonal care and maintenance to the septic tanks system. Listed are several tips for year-round care and maintenance across the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Taking proper care of the septic system is crucial in preparing for the harsh winter weather.
- Consider pumping the sewage tank before winter arrives, as doing so becomes hard in the winter months.
- During the fall season, limit the use of lawn mowers in the area near the sewage tank, while do not use vehicles in this area by any means.
- Moreover, take measures to shield the treatment area from freezing.
Winter
Taking care of septic systems during the winter can pose substantial hurdles, particularly in freezing weather. That's why, it's wise to start preparing for the winter season ahead of time, preferably in the fall.
The most important care you can offer your septic tank system during winter includes regularly inspecting the commonly affected zones where septic systems are prone to freezing, with the goal of avoiding this problem. These areas include:
- The conduit leading from the house's tank
- The piping leading to the soil treatment zone
- The section for soil treatment
- In addition to the waste tank
Spring
- Taking care of your septic system during spring involves the following steps:
- As the sun begins to shine and the snow starts melting, it's the perfect time to schedule a expert inspection of your septic tank. This inspection 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ime provides a great moment to change your septic tank filter. The filter may be obstructed during the winter months, potentially causing septic system issues.
- Spring is an opportune moment to schedule a tank maintenance. This helps maintain the efficiency of your septic tank.
Summer
Proper septic system maintenance for the summer season involves the following steps:
- Warm weather in the summer can intensify the septic tank odors, so homeowners should be prepared to seek professional septic tank services during the summer months.
- The use of water tends to go up during the summer, causing more water going into your septic tank. To mitigate this, switch to high-efficiency toilets that are more water-efficient.
FAQs
QUESTION: What is the recommended frequency for septic tank pumping?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, yet usually, septic tanks should be pumped about every every three to five years.
QUESTION:What measures can I take to safeguard my septic tank from potential system failure?
ANSWER: To ensure the longevity of your septic tank, it's crucial to carry out regular schedule professional septic tank inspections.
QUESTION: Which septic tank system is the most excellent?
ANSWER: In reality, every septic tank variety is effective as far as proper maintenance is performed. Yet, before placing a septic system, a few factors to take into account. These factors include climate conditions, the scale of the property, and more.
QUESTION:How long is the standard timeframe for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Several variables influence the timeframe required for septic tank installation. These factors include the weather, the size of the septic tank, the specific type of septic tank, and other factors. Nevertheless, when accounting for all factors, the installation process typically generally shouldn't surpass a span of 1 to 2 weeks.
